Hello all,

We are aiming at standard attachment transfer from SRM SC item to backend ECC PO item.

We are on SRM server 5.5 SP9 CLASSIC scenario.

Service docserver is active for SRM.

In BADI for back end PO method FILL_PO_INTERFACE1 , we have specified

cs_ctrl_att-TRANSFER_ACTIVE = 'X'.

In ECC DC10 we have doc <b>SRM</b> set as per config guide.

In ECC DC30 all file types have been defined.

In ECC the document storage path is defined under ECC SPRO ->Cross-Application Components->Document Management->General Data->Define Data Carrier->Define mount points / logical drive->as

data carrier=<b>ZSRM</b>

Type=<b>PC</b>

Prefix for access path =
10.20.11.200\egat$\srm_share_doc

But when I create attachment to my SC item and study BBP_PD.

if I check the table BBP_PDATT --> I can not see any entry in the URL field.

also if I check BBP_PD_SC_GETDETAIL for this SC as you had said

go to export parameter <b>ET_ATTACH</b> I can see 1 entry

but if I check DISP_URL i get

http://erpdevsrci.egat.co.th:8010/sap/ebp/docserver/Storage%20location%20not%20available%20for%20ind...

I feel some correction is needed for Doc server path in our ECC system.

Thanks.

But another thread helped us.

We influenced two more parameters.

BE_DOC_TYPE

BE_STORAGE_CAT

in BADI

and it worked.
